Description

Distinguished in the market by its strong, pragmatic approach for the introductory speech or human communication student, Communicating, 8/e, offers comprehensive, balanced coverage of basic communication theory, interpersonal and group communication, and public speaking skills. Strengthening this practical approach, relevant examples and exercises motivate students to develop and apply their new skills. The authors address a diverse student audience, with a special focus for returning adult learners. Coverage of perception is highlighted in chapters on small groups, nonverbal communication, and interviewing. Skill Boxes in each chapter provide useful advice on handling situations students will confront in college and beyond. Contemporary Communication Issues relates communication theory to such real-world issues as sexual harassment, freedom of speech, political correctness, and multiculturalism.
